And the winner is...MN Girls' Hockey Hub Top Performer revealed

By Kassondra Burtis, SportsEngine, 01/18/22, 10:30AM CST

See who fans voted as the top performer from Jan. 10-15.

Top performer winner

Iyla Ryskamp, Orono. The senior forward sits seventh in both assists (28) and points (55) across the state this season and averages 3.24 points per game. On Jan. 13, Ryskamp tallied five goals — including three within a 10-minute span during the second period — and added one assist to lead the Spartans' 9-2 victory at Bloomington Jefferson.

Top performer candidates

Mercury Bischoff, Grand Rapids-Greenway. As a freshman, Bischoff is among the state’s leading scorers, ranking seventh in goals scored (33) and tied for eighth in points (50). Bischoff, who is averaging 2.5 points per game this season, led the Lightning’s two wins last week by recording points on every team goal. Bischoff tallied four goals and an assist in the Lightning's 5-0 victory against Duluth Marshall on Jan. 11. At Elk River/Zimmerman on Jan. 14, Bischoff recorded a hat trick and an assist in the 4-2 win. One of her goals last week was on a power play and two were shorthanded.

Avery Chesek, Eastview. The senior forward tallied 14 points through three Lightning wins last week. At Dodge County on Jan. 12, Chesek recorded her first hat trick of the season — including one power play goal and one shorthanded — and added two assists in the Lightning’s 6-0 win. The next night, Chesek assisted on all of the Lightning’s goals as they edged Lakeville North 5-4 in overtime. One assist was shorthanded and two were on power plays. In the Lightning's third win of the week, Chesek recorded her second hat trick and added an assist as they defeated Apple Valley 4-1 on Jan. 15.

Jennifer Rupp, Irondale/St. Anthony. The junior goaltender, who faces an average of nearly 40 shots on goal per game this season, posted a season-high .979 save percentage in the Knights’ 1-1 overtime tie against White Bear Lake on Jan. 15. Rupp made 47 saves.

Olivia Van Siclen, Two Rivers/St. Paul. Van Siclen recorded a season-high five points on Jan. 14, leading the Riveters’ 7-1 victory against Mahtomedi. The senior forward scored a pair of goals — including one shorthanded — and tallied two power play assists and a third at even strength.

*Stats and records as of Jan. 16.
